Overcoming the challenges of Plasmodium falciparum histidine-rich protein 2 and 3 deletions in malaria diagnosis and control

Abstract

Malaria is a major public health concern responsible for significant mortality and morbidity, especially in sub-Saharan Africa. Accurate diagnosis is crucial for effective malaria control and elimination strategies. Recent studies have confirmed the existence of Plasmodium falciparum histidine-rich protein 2 and 3 (Pfhrp2/3) deficient malaria parasites, which pose significant challenges to malaria diagnosis and control. This review provides a comprehensive overview of the existing literature on Pfhrp2/3 deletions and their implications on malaria diagnosis and control. A literature search was conducted using a combination of keywords (Pfhrp2/3 deletions, malaria diagnosis, malaria control, rapid diagnostic tests) and medical subject headings (MeSH) terms (Malaria/diagnosis, Malaria/parasitology, Plasmodium falciparum/genetics) in ScienceDirect, Springer, Google Scholar, and PubMed. Studies published in English between 2018 and 2024 were included, and a total of 83 studies were selected for inclusion in the review based on predefined inclusion and exclusion criteria. This review highlights the significant challenges posed by Pfhrp2/3 deletions to malaria diagnosis and control and identifies potential solutions, including alternative diagnostic approaches and novel RDTs targeting multiple antigens.
